### Thumbnail queue stalls — Pixelforge Media

If thumbnails stop appearing, first check the queue depth on the worker dashboard; a depth above 10,000 usually means a poison message. Requeue it to the dead-letter topic and restart one worker, not all. To inspect stuck jobs directly, call the queue admin API with the bearer token below.

portal login ticket: eyJhbGciOiJIUzI1NiIsInR5cCI6IkpXVCJ9.eyJzdWIiOiIwEOsktwVNwIn0.-UJU3fdyyCgG

## When a flag rollout goes sideways

Hey support folks — if a customer reports weird behavior mid-rollout, it's usually Driftwell (our feature-flag framework) doing a staged percentage bump. First check the rollout dashboard; if the flag is between 0 and 100 percent, inconsistency across sessions is expected. Don't toggle anything yourself — page the owning team instead. To sanity-check what the evaluator is doing, compare against the current production settings, shown here.

deployment values, bagag-bawig:
DRUVAN_PIN=0740
DRUVAN_TENANT=wendor
DRUVAN_METRICS_HOST=metrics.druvan.tolvaqnet.example
DRUVAN_SEAL=seal_75cd0b2d
DRUVAN_STANDBY_TEAM=tamael

Subject: Quickstore 4.2 — bloom filter now fronts the KV layer

Plugin authors: starting with this release, Quickstore places a bloom filter ahead of the key-value store. Negative lookups return faster; false positives fall through safely. No API changes are required on your side. Verify your plugin against the staging build referenced below.

session token of fahif-tadup = htk3_9c7

## Service Account: dedupe-bot

Hey support folks — the Quietbell deduplicator collapses duplicate pages before they hit on-call, running as `svc-dedupe`. If alerts look suspiciously merged, check its logs in Hushboard first. It only reads the alert stream and writes suppression tags, nothing else. It authenticates with the key below.

API key for yahig-tadup: kto7_ubizbYm